Transaction 75074283f6ae5425d134ac08b2d4614733a489043096dc6c5701aa59ae13781d
1 Input
2 Outputs
- 75074283f6ae5425d134ac08b2d4614733a489043096dc6c5701aa59ae13781d:0
- 75074283f6ae5425d134ac08b2d4614733a489043096dc6c5701aa59ae13781d:1
value 10000
address 2N8VYPy8dKjgGf9rE21ycSeviMpMGnh4ZiA
value 335247
address mp74xf3V2BAp75Bv4JejJsUYgjeeAujxbS